Barcelona midfielder Andres Iniesta believes that he wouldn't be the same player if he were not at the Catalan club.
The 28-year-old, widely regarded as one of the best midfield players in the world, came through the club's youth academy before establishing himself in the first team.
"I don't know if I would be the same player that I am today if I had played somewhere else, I don't know if I would be better or worse," he told Barca Magazine.
"I have been and continue to be in the ideal club to grow as a player. Barcelona are the reason why I am the player that I am today. I have no doubt.
"It's important to believe in a style of play, in a player profile, but it always has to be married to success. We can't forget that without succeeding, the story is different."
Iniesta has made 415 appearances for Barcelona.
